Universal Credit: Payments

Question for Department for Work and Pensions

UIN 121901, tabled on 10 January 2018

To ask the Secretary of State for Work and Pensions, whether any applications for universal credit payments to be split between adults in a household have been declined.

Answered on

15 January 2018

The information requested is not collected in a form that would allow it to be aggregated across all cases to provide the information required.

Named day
Named day questions only occur in the House of Commons. The MP tabling the question specifies the date on which they should receive an answer. MPs may not table more than five named day questions on a single day.
